I use battery tenders on everything I own, the 350 being no exception, especially being that it might sit for a week or two without being driven.
I've just popped the hood and put the alligator clips on the battery and gently put the hood down...I did try using the adapter that they give you with the Tender, but it was too short and I've not had time to extend it.
I did that today...extended the cable and mounted the socket to the tow hook with some tie wraps.
Getting a rough cable length
Original with the clips
Snipped off
Extended and ready to install
Everything loomed and tie wrapped
Ran it down in front of the rad support and out the frame rail
Much easier...
